Boost Mobile robbers elude Police Monday night, remain at large in Kankakee

KANKAKEE – Two unidentified men made off with an undisclosed amount of electronics at a Boost Mobile store Monday night.

According to reports the men implied they had a gun while at the 1650 E Court Street location before taking off with a variety of electronics including tablets, phones and AirPods.

No one was reported hurt in the robbery which was followed by a short chase.  Details are limited at this time, but the suspects managed to elude law enforcement and remain at large.
